The Employment Application form serves as a key document for job seekers in Ohio, particularly emphasizing the job application format for resumes. This form requires personal information, employment eligibility questions, educational history, and a record of employment experience. It accommodates users by allowing them to describe their duties, responsibilities, and special skills in a clear manner. The form mandates the inclusion of both business and personal references, ensuring a comprehensive background check. It also invites veterans to disclose their service details, enhancing inclusivity. Users must certify the accuracy of their responses and allow for background checks, emphasizing the importance of honesty in the application process.
